Alpha Marine Signs Contract for New 47m Hybrid

Greek design studio and naval architects, Alpha Marine Ltd, has announced that it has signed the contract for a 47m diesel-electric hybrid superyacht. Aptly named, ‘The First’, the new vessel will be constructed in Greece, with her keel laying planned to begin later in 2022. She will be branded under the new superyacht firm, ProMarine Yachts.

Commissioned by an experienced owner, the first hull within the new semi-custom series will become one of the few yachts of her size to be equipped with a cutting-edge hybrid system and Azimuth thrusters. 

‘The First’ will feature exterior design by Alpha Marine, who has created a curvaceous profile with smooth lines and carefully carved angles. Her silhouette is set to be timeless: characterised by practical and high-quality elegant finishes.     

Yacht Designer & Naval Architect, Aristotelis Betsis, commented on the process of designing her exterior: ‘The owner had in mind what he liked and what he didn’t, but the yacht should not only satisfy the owner’s taste. She has also to satisfy the taste of a greater audience, as this yacht comes first in the owner’s new venture. A long concept realisation process was followed until we reached the final design. The result is a super elegant modern-classic yacht with all the dynamism a younger audience would look for.’

Notably, the Greek design studio is also responsible for the naval architecture of ‘The First’, meticulously developing a slender, under 500GT hull that offers not only low resistance and spectacular seakeeping characteristics, but also ample volume for an array of amenities and facilities onboard. She has also been designed, and will be built to, the highest RINA classifications. 

‘We created a new hull from scratch which could accommodate the yacht’s requirements in the best possible way,’ expanded Thomas Gkouliouras, Technical Director and Naval Architect at Alpha Marine Ltd, ‘but our task does not end there. The structural design has been simple enough to ease the building process and sophisticated enough to reduce the weight and increase the strength of the yacht.’

Offering a variety of internal configurations, including the option for accommodating 10 guests across five cabins, or 12 across six, the new hybrid series has been created to offer the ultimate onboard experience. Designed for living at sea long-term, or chartering short-term, ‘The First’ boasts incredible flexibility through a wide range of water toys, ample storage facilities, a separate crew circulation as well as comfortable accommodation and living areas for both scenarios.

Nikos Dafnias, Founder & CEO of Alpha Marine Ltd, stated: ‘This yacht has been a dream to come true for the owner for many years. It took numerous long meetings in order to be able to compile a sufficient briefing and work out solutions to conclude with a project winning result. I am happy to say that our team’s ethos, experience and talent can be represented by the final result.’
